How to Restore a Ford Model A Coupe

A Model A Ford Coupe is a beautiful car and one that is a favorite of car enthusiasts to restore. Are you interested in beginning a similar project of your own?

Instructions

    • 1

      Read about Ford Model A Fords by doing research online, or by reading books like "How to Restore the Model A Ford" and others. Books like these help you know what to look for when searching for a car to restore.

    • 2

      Find a Ford Model A Coupe to restore. Look in the classifieds or publications like Uncle Henry's.

    • 3

      Go online. There you can find Ford Model A Coupes listed for sale on sites like Hemming's Motor News, eBay, Craigslist and more.

    • 4

      Inspect each Ford Model A Coupe carefully before considering it. If you are uncertain whether the vehicle is a good buy, bring someone with you who is mechanically inclined to help you. Don't jump on the first car you view. Take your time and purchase the right vehicle.

    • 5

      Prepare a place in your garage where you will work on the vehicle. As this might be a project that could take up to a year or more, make certain that this place is heated and protected from the weather. This is especially important in areas of the country where there is snow.

    • 6

      Strip the Ford Model A Coupe down to the frame and repair it if necessary. Take apart the rest of the parts and lubricate them, replacing any bolts and fasteners as needed.

    • 7

      Attend to the engine, cleaning it and replacing plugs, wires, lubricants, belts and hoses. Update any engine parts as needed.

    • 8

      Begin reassembling the frame, replacing the suspension and springs as you do so. Restore the body as well, repairing any damage or rust. Strip the body panels and prime them.

    • 9

      Reassemble the drive train and replace the engine. Reattach the gears. Restore the wheels and rims, and mount new tires. Mount tires on frame.

    • 10

      Put the Ford Model A body back on the frame and reattached the doors, fenders and running boards.

    • 11

      Reupholster the seat and install. Paint the body and polish any chrome to finish the restore project.

Tips & Warnings

  • Restoring any vehicle is a major project, and the Ford Model A is no exception. This article gives you a very general idea of what is involved in this project, but it should not be used as a substitution for a proper restoration manual, which may run into the hundreds of pages.
